The … WebbLife-cycle analysis (LCA), also known as life-cycle assessment, is a primary tool used to support decision-making for sustainable development. According to the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ency, LCA is a tool to evaluate the potential environmental impacts of a product, material, process, or activity. WebbNike has major control over their distribution and sale of their products. In America Nike has more than 200,000 retailers and has its presence in more than 150 countries in the world. Nike has its manufacturing units in almost every country to minimize the logistics costs and getter better efficiency in the distribution (MBA Skool, 2024).
